The Public Building Commission of Chicago ("Commission" or "PBC") has enhanced education, safety, and recreation across the region by building or renovating hundreds of schools, city co leges, libraries, parks, shorelines, fire houses, police stations and other public facilities. PBC User Agencies include the City of Chicago, Chicago Department of Transportation, Chicago Park District, U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(USACE) - Chicago District, Chicago Public Library, City Co leges of Chicago, Forest Preserve District of Cook County, Cook County, Chicago Public Schools, and other municipalities and partners. The Commission, through this Request for Qualifications ("RFQ"), solicits the qualifications of General Contractors (including firms proposing to have a contro ling interest in Joint Ventures) to perform marine coastal protection, park land drainage system, and landscaping construction work. Upon prequalification, the PBC intends to facilitate a competitive bid process whereby only the prequalified firms can competitively bid for work. The term "General Contractor" means any person who, as an investment or for compensation or with the intent to se l or to lease, (i) arranges or submits a bid or offers to undertake or purports to have the capacity to undertake or undertakes, through himself or through others, to erect, construct, alter, repair, move, insta l, replace, convert, remodel, rehabilitate, modernize, improve or make additions to any shoreline, park land, land, structure and/or building or to any appurtenance thereto attached to real estate and located within the area delineated by the Contract Documents, including, but not limited to, pathways, roadways, trails, beaches, revetments, marine shoals, flooding prevention, erosion management, driveways, swimming areas, decks, garages, fences, fa lout shelters and any other accessory objects or uses; and ( i) retains for themselves control over the means, method and manner of accomplishing the desired result; and ( i) whose business operations, in whole or in part, require the hiring or supervision of one or more persons from any building trade or craft, including, but not limited to, plumbing, concrete, electrical, heating, air-conditioning, earthwork, exterior improvements, utilities, thermal and moisture protection, or carpentry, and marine construction. The PBC further defines "General Contractor" as meaning the partnership, firm, corporation, joint venture or entity entering into the Contract with the Commission to perform the Work required by the Contract Documents. The Commission may solicit bids for various construction-related projects undertaken by the Commission on behalf of various User Agencies. Projects may consist of the construction and/or renovation of various facilities to be used by various agencies in the furnishing of governmental, health, safety and welfare services. The range of projects that may be solicited include anywhere from major capital improvements to the remodel of a single existing bathroom, the addition of a fence on a property or general site work. DESCRIPTION OF GENERAL CONSTRUCTION WORK General Contractors awarded contracts for PBC projects will be responsible for providing all required labor and materials, equipment, supervision and administration necessary to complete the scope of work (“Work”) described in the bid solicitation, including but not limited marine coastal protection, park land drainage system, and landscaping construction work. The Work will be supervised and administered on behalf of PBC by the PBC’s authorized Commission representative and such staff personnel as shall be determined by PBC in accordance with procedures established by the Commission. Specific work for assigned projects may include, but shall not be limited to, the following: 1. Confirming project scope 2. Procuring all materials, equipment, labor and vendor services 3. Providing and maintaining sufficient staffing 4. Providing any/all general requirements 5. Completing the punch list corrective work and turnover requirements 6. Submitting samples, shop drawings and reports 7. Procuring all permits, licenses and approvals 8. Providing warranties, testing and operations manuals 9. Properly managing, coordinating and performing environmental remediation, and/or related work 10. Providing insurance and performance and payment bond 11. Complying with all directives and policies of the Commission 12. Participating in periodic project coordination meetings 13. Meeting with the representatives of the Commission and the User, as required 14. Preparing and submitting timely reports concerning the progress of work 15. Complying with MBE/WBE/DBE, City Residency, EEO, Community Hiring and other requirements 16. Maximizing hiring opportunities for community members Work will be performed in compliance with all applicable rules, codes and regulations; will consist of the specific obligations described in the bid solicitation for this project; and shall be performed in accordance with commonly known CSI Divisions identified below.
